Carlsberg Pilsner is the flagship in the Carlsberg Group's portfolio of beers. A regular in millions of bars across 140 countries world wide it is a truly international brand and pilsner beer of exceptional taste and quality. <br /><br />Taste and ingredients:<br /><br />Carlsberg Pilsner is a well-proportioned bottom-fermented lager beer with a flavour of hops, grains, pine needles, sorrel and Danish summer apples. The bitterness of the hops and the apple-like sweetness provide a harmoniously balanced taste. Should ideally be enjoyed at 7-10 C. <br /><br />Carlsberg Pilsner & Food:<br /><br />Carlsberg Pilsner goes well with Asian foods, buffets, vegetable or fish soups, lightly seasoned fish dishes and in particular roast meat with gravy. <br /><br />The Carlsberg logo:<br /><br />Architect Thorvald Bindesboell designed the world famous art nouveau Carlsberg logo for the launch of Carlsberg pilsner in 1904. With the logo, this pioneer in Danish design forever left is mark on Denmark's leading beer maker. He was paid 500 kroner for the design - it was expensive at the time, but it turned out to be money well spent. And like the beer, the award winning logo has stood the test of time, remaining largely unchanged to this very day.<br /><br />The Carlsberg Yeast:<br /><br />Without good yeast, you don't get great beer, and Carlsberg's is exceptional. In the late 1800's the head of the Carlsberg Brewing laboratory, Emil Christian Hansen, pioneered a groundbreaking method for propagating pure yeast. His discovery, and the resulting yeast, aptly named "Saccharomyces Carlsbergensis" would revolutionise the brewing industry. In fact, the yeast's effect on the beer was so extraordinary that Carlsberg chose to share the yeast with the world by giving it away to other brewers for free. To this day, whenever and wherever you enjoy a lager, there's probably a little Carlsberg in it.
